The Eureka Wildcats s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 2-1 victory over the North Point Grizzlies on Saturday. That's two games straight that Eureka have won by just one goal.
The win made it two in a row for Eureka and bumps their season record up to 2-1. As for North Point, their defeat dropped their record down to 3-1.
Eureka has already played their next contest (against Webster Groves),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ing. As for North Point, they also wasted no time getting back out on the pitch and have already played their next match, a 6-0 victory against Lutheran on the 31st.
